Eli Zaretskii wrote in a message to All:

EZ> What's wrong with running ``diff -c -r'' on the old and new
EZ> directories?   That's what I do, anyway.  Makes me immune to
EZ> possible errors and  omissions of whoever prepares the list you are
EZ> asking for (what with the  weird hours those persons work ;-).

The problem with this approach that you for every single change you have to grasp immediately why this was changed. You really grasp that??

A list serves another purpose: as a list of things which should have been changed (but maybe hasn't or incorrectly).
